
A recent news report in Japan highlighted how the game Ghost of Yotei has become significant for the Hokkaido region that served as its inspiration.
A Yodobashi employee in Sapporo says the PS5 game, released last week, is incredibly popular, selling very quickly. They expect it to be one of the year’s biggest hits on the PlayStation 5 in Japan.
The game has become so popular that local shops are now allowed to make and sell their own unique Ghost of Yotei items, such as wooden keychains and coasters. Plus, the government believes the game can attract more tourists to the area.

The island of Tsushima also saw a positive impact, with the local government recognizing developer Sucker Punch for its contributions to the area.
PlayStation recently teamed up with Klook to offer tours of real-world locations featured in the game, and it sounds like a fantastic experience we’d definitely be interested in!
